Wacker Neuson Compact Dumper Line

Sept. 28, 2010

 

A new product-line offering to the U.S. market, the Wacker Neuson compact dumpers boast permanent four-wheel, hydrostatic drive for rough-terrain applications. The smallest of three units introduced, the 16.5-horsepower 1001 has a payload of 2,205 pounds, ideal for jobsite clean-up and residential landscaping. With payloads of 6,614 and 13,227 pounds, respectively, the 48.8-horsepower 3001 and 82-horsepower 6001 each has a power swivel, which allows the material-placing operator to dump at the front or either side of the unit. The addition of dumpers to a rough-terrain jobsite will, says Wacker Neuson, allow other machine types such as skid steers and wheel loaders to perform duties for which they are better suited. Estimated list price: $30,000 to $65,000.
